Q:
How can I reduce the latency of my Emagic Logic for Windows with my Universal Audio UAD1 plugins?
A:
Make sure you have the latest drivers for the UAD1, and make sure you have Logic 4.81, which has a special setting for this problem. Go to Audio - Audio Preferences, and at the bottom of the page, checkmark the Plug-In Delay Compensation and hit Close.
If this doesn't help, try starting a new song without loading your autoload by holding CTRL while clicking File-New. Also try trashing your preferences by searching your Windows directory for a file called LOGIC32.PRF. Simply delete this file and restart Logic. Between these three suggestions, your latency issue should be resolved.
